Brooks City-Base: Overview

Brooks City-Base, which was as recently as 2002 known as Brooks Air Force Base, is run by the Brooks Development Authority. This is a joint venture between the local, state and federal governments. The purpose of this venture is to develop the area into a center of science, business, and technology. The Air Force still maintains a significant presence here and the 311th Human System Wing (HSW) is the primary entity. The mission of the 311 HSW is to foster the development of and further the capabilities of humans and human-systems performance. The range of this mission includes the development of not only the individual, but also an entire force entity.

The name of the base is in honor of Sidney Johnson Brooks, Jr., who was lost in a flight training incident in San Antonio prior to World War I. The Army Air Corps established Brooks Field as its primary flight school until 1931. At that point, Brooks Field became the Army’s Aerial Observation Center. This mission continued into the World War II era, but was terminated in 1943. The installation was then used for training B-25 crews. Once the Air Force was established as a separate service, the installation became known as Brooks Air Force Base. Basically, the base has been, for lack of a better term, a center for research since the 1950’s.

Brooks City-Base: Location

The Brooks City-Base is located just to the southeast San Antonio Texas, which is in Bexar County. From the base, it is only about 7 miles to downtown San Antonio. San Antonio has a strong military presence since there are so many military installations located in the vicinity. Also located within the vicinity are a number of great towns, such as Kirby, Leon Valley, Converse, Live Oak, Universal City, Schertz, New Braunfels, Pleasanton, Seguin, Canyon Lake, Hondo, San Marcos, Kyle, Kerrville, and Lockhart. Visiting the Gulf Coast can be accomplished in a 2 – 2 ½ hour drive to Corpus Christi.

Brooks City-Base: Interesting Facts

  • Brooks AFB was place on the Base Realignment and Closure list in 1995. It was eventually decided to slowly transition the ownership of the base to the City of San Antonio.
  • The USAF School of Aerospace Medicine (SAM) was moved to Brooks in 1957. SAM scientists worked with NASA on Project Mercury.
  • Brooks Field was once used for balloon and airship cadet training. The program was cancelled in 1922.
